Klorin Posts: 262

Hello,
done some testing today on K850i and N82 camera wise.

First I would like to say that I had the K850i for 8 months or so, I know that camera pretty well compared to the N82 camera.

This is MY experience and result with them:

The test I've done today is done in bright daylight/sunny weather.

With both cameras on full auto the K850 pics are a tad sharper then N82 pictures I take but the K850i has some blue tint in them.

If I use landscape mode the N82 pics get as sharp as the K850 pictures. The option hard makes them even sharper but is very dependent on holding the camera still.
